Exercise: Walk around the neighborhood w/ DH (almost mile) If you like mushrooms, you will love these mushroom appetizers I made last night. It's just large mushrooms, cream cheese, monterey jack cheese, and butter. You take off the stems, chop them up, melt the cream cheese, add the cheddar, take the filling and put them in the caps, add the caps to a baking dish with melted butter and bake. Yummy!!
